pattern-library checked

React Spectrum NumberField

Documents number fields with visible labels, required state, accessible naming, raw numeric form submission, locale-aware formatting, min and max values, clamping on blur, step values, stepper buttons, arrow-key and button commitment, units, percentages, and currency values.

Open source

Pattern Decisions This Source Supports

Pattern Supported decision Required contract Claim note
Spinbutton / numeric stepper Choose a spinbutton for one bounded numeric value that changes in predictable increments. Increment and decrement controls change the value by the declared step and stop at the lower and upper bounds. React Spectrum documents NumberField labels, min and max clamping, step values, stepper buttons, raw form submission, locale formatting, units, percentages, and currency values.

Evidence Role

This source is treated as pattern-library evidence. Use it to validate the decision rules above, not as a visual style reference.

Publisher: Adobe React Spectrum. Last checked: .